Supreme Court of Colorado
County of Boulder v. Boulder and Weld County Ditch Co
March 21, 20162016 CO 17
Summary
The court affirmed dismissal of Boulder County’s application because the County failed to prove the historical consumptive use of the water right it sought to change. The County’s analysis did not reliably establish the quantity of water historically delivered or that the claimed acreage was irrigated with the relevant water right, preventing the County from showing that the proposed change would not injure other users. Because the proposed exchange depended on the denied change of use and was not independently sufficient, its denial was also affirmed.
